### Runbook 4.2 — Account Recovery: Payment Retry Idempotency

When restoring a Ledgerock merchant account, verify every retried charge reuses its original idempotency key; regenerating keys mid-recovery causes duplicate captures. Audit the key ledger before re-enabling the retry worker. Unsealing the key ledger after a recovery event requires the passphrase recorded immediately below:

strongbox words: fenwyn-lamix-novael-holeth-sorix-druael-lamwyn

**Q: The Larkspur interns arrive Monday — what do night shift need to know?**

About a dozen interns from the Larkspur cohort will start trickling in early, some before 7am because of their orientation schedule. Their permanent badges won't be ready until Wednesday, so let them through the east lobby if they're on Priya's list. Until then, use the temporary cohort code below.

turnstile pass: bdg-QZV-3

Hi Renata, confirming the Veylith audit-log viewer cut-over completed at 02:10 local with no user-facing errors. Old viewer is read-only until Friday, after which we decommission it. Ingest lag stayed under two seconds throughout, and the verification queries matched on all sampled tenants. For your records, the production configuration the new viewer is now running with is included below.

settings of bahop-kaweg:
[novael]
host = novael.braskstack.example
user = novael_svc
database = novael_prod

Handover: Crashfall pipeline (from Teo)

Welcome aboard. The crash-report pipeline ingests symbolicated reports from the Lumen mobile app, batches them, and pushes aggregates hourly. Watch the symbolication queue — it backs up when a new app version ships and symbols lag. Dedup runs before aggregation, so raw counts will look inflated upstream; that's expected. The pipeline currently runs with the following configuration values.

settings of kawig-kahip:
ULAETH_PIN=4988
ULAETH_TENANT=briath
ULAETH_METRICS_HOST=metrics.ulaeth.xolmarworks.test
ULAETH_SEAL=seal_e1a2fe42
ULAETH_STANDBY_TEAM=pelix